Output 7aeef1883c7eba18f6d1fd8dc0f63f00fdc61f8dbc35b5fc1edab3dde0951f1c:11

value
1351389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e22b0d55d4d06ab8c419308f68222ee66158fc OP_EQUAL
address
33xb5b3ZBvQcJ7R4GF9kQN8wug79gF4n9T
transaction
7aeef1883c7eba18f6d1fd8dc0f63f00fdc61f8dbc35b5fc1edab3dde0951f1c
confirmations
236515
spent
true